Engine component with modification area for influencing crack propagation and method of manufacturing

1. An engine component comprising:
at least one first loading zone, configured for dynamic loads arising at the engine component when the engine component is built into an engine and when the engine is operating,
a second loading zone, spaced at a distance from the first loading zone on the engine component and configured for dynamic loads arising at the engine component when the engine component is built into the engine and when the engine is operating,
at least one spatially delimited modification zone with introduced internal tensile stress formed on the engine component, wherein via the at least one spatially delimited modification zone, a crack propagating in the engine component is at least one chosen from guided to the second loading zone and guided within the second loading zone to avoid crack propagation in the first loading zone; and
wherein the at least one spatially delimited modification zone is provided in the second loading zone.
